Order Routing Strategies

Imagine you are driving through a busy city to reach a specific destination fast. You encounter many different paths, some with heavy traffic and others that remain completely clear. Choosing the right route requires constant adjustments based on real-time data about the changing road conditions. Smart order routing works exactly like this navigation system for digital financial trades. It ensures that an order reaches the best possible market location to get the best price. Without this intelligent navigation, trades might get stuck in slow or expensive exchange lanes. Traders rely on these systems to maintain speed and efficiency in a fragmented market structure.
The Logic of Smart Order Routers
Financial markets consist of many different exchanges that all compete for your trade orders. A smart order router acts as the central brain that evaluates these many venues simultaneously. It scans the current landscape to find where the highest liquidity exists for a specific asset. This process happens in mere microseconds, long before a human trader could even blink their eyes. The router must decide whether to send the entire order to one place or split it up. By splitting the order into smaller pieces, the system avoids moving the price against the trader. This strategy keeps the total transaction cost lower than sending one massive order to a single exchange.
Key term: Smart order router — an automated system that scans multiple trading venues to find the best execution price for a financial order.
Think of the router as a professional shopper who wants the best deal on a rare item. If the shopper finds only half of the items at one store, they check other nearby locations. They do not buy everything at the first store if the price is higher elsewhere. This keeps the shopper from depleting the stock at one place and driving up the price. The router applies this same logic to stocks, bonds, and other traded assets in global markets. It balances the need for speed with the requirement to get the best possible financial outcome.
Navigating Market Fragmentation
Modern markets are highly fragmented, meaning assets trade across a dozen different public and private venues. This fragmentation makes the task of the router much harder than it was in the past. The system must account for various rules and delays that exist at each specific trading location. If a router sends an order to a slow exchange, the price might change before the trade finishes. To manage this, the software uses complex algorithms to predict how each venue will likely behave. The following table highlights how routers compare different venues when they decide where to send orders:
| Feature | Public Exchange | Private Dark Pool | Retail Broker |
|---|---|---|---|
| Visibility | Fully transparent | Hidden liquidity | Order flow data |
| Speed | High frequency | Moderate speed | Variable delay |
| Cost | Standard fees | Lowered costs | Broker margins |
These factors force the router to constantly update its strategy based on the current market state. It must follow strict regulations to ensure that every trade gets fair treatment under the law. If the router fails to find the best price, the firm might face serious regulatory fines. Therefore, the software requires constant updates to keep pace with new market rules and technology changes. Developers spend their entire careers refining these routing paths to shave off extra nanoseconds of delay. This constant optimization is what allows modern finance to function at such a massive, rapid scale.
Smart order routers act as intelligent traffic controllers that dynamically shift trade orders across multiple venues to secure the most favorable execution prices for investors.
The next Station introduces network topologies, which determines how the physical hardware connects to support these complex routing decisions.
This content is educational only and does not constitute financial or investment advice.